Welcome to my blog. Chances are you're here for one of two reasons: you're part of the healthy-living, exercising, weight-losing blogosphere OR my mom gave you this blog address to see what I'm up to nowadays.

I started blogging sporadically at my old (retired) blog "Mes Belles Lettres" back in 2007 in order to prepare for and then document my study abroad in France in 2008. After returning to the states, I pretty much stopped blogging all together. That is, until early 2010, when my boyfriend Jon convinced me to sign up for a 5k that would happen the same day as the half marathon he was training for. I found Couch to 5K, stumbled across blogs of fellow C25Kers, decided to create my first blog "En Route to 'En' Shape," and never looked back.

"En Route to 'En' Shape" originally just chronicled my runs during C25K, but it quickly morphed into a place to talk about WeightWatchers (I used to be member), healthy living, cooking, and my life in general. Then, with my decision to spend the 2010-2011 school year in France teaching English to French elementary school kids, everyone got to see me talk about all of those things from my cozy apartment in Provence. After moving back to the states, I realized that I already considered myself "en shape" and a runner and I was focused less on losing weight (since I feel pretty good about where I am) and more focused on leading a healthy lifestyle and improving my running.  Alas, blog #2 was retired and "Eat, Run, Read" was born.




With ERR I hope to chronicle the next phase in my life.  I'm currently back in the state of Ohio and living in Columbus with my fabulous boyfriend, our super cuddly dog Sahara, and our occasionally bitchy (but also adorable) cat Fiona.  So, I hope you join me as I work on all the reading that comes with working towards my MA, strive to be a better runner, and cook yummy and healthy things.  :)
